Unity - Gestalt
This image below is representative of one of the many Gestalt Principles. The principle that is being expressed in this image is proximity. The fifteen human figures put closely together makes the whole image look like a tree.
Louise Nevelson
This piece, called Rain Garden II, is very unique. When I look at it, it looks to me like a garden full of different kinds of fruits and vegetables. I can never get tired of looking at this piece of artwork because there are so many different shapes to observe within the whole piece. It is said that she creates her work by using things that people would normally throw out and brings new life to them that wasn't intentionally made to be.
